Danbury dental clinic sets up shop in schools (WNPR Connecticut Public Radio)
A recent Department of Public Health report found that almost 50 percent of Latino children in Connecticut experience oral decay. There's a growing sense in the state that putting dental clinics in schools may be the best way to prevent students from missing school because of dental pain.
